Fast 3D visualization of road product models
Due to its monolithic nature, 3D visualization software integrated with legacy engineering applications contain every possible feature you might use-whether or not a user really wants them. With the advent of distributed objects and interpreted platform-independent languages such as Java and VRML it is possible to develop cross-platform portable 3D visualization software as components that work in an easy-to-use manner. Adopting these advances, fast 3D visualization can considerably simplify the job of maintaining the life cycle of a road integrated within an agreed road product model. The paper aims to introduce new levels of support to engineers throughout the integrated product life cycle by dealing with issues such as fast platform-independent 3D visualization and product modelling using roads as an example.
